OpenShip Systems is the advanced OpenShip capability. It publishes one self-contained JSON document containing a complete Sources snapshot, a typed architecture graph, and optional context for humans and agents.

Systems is JSON-only in v1. Legacy directory or YAML bundles are not canonical OpenShip Systems representations.

source.manifest and source.bundle MUST form a valid, complete Sources snapshot. External URLs or omitted contents are not self-contained and are non-conformant.

Nodes and containment

Node kinds are closed in v1:

KindMeaning
RootThe logical boundary of the described system.
HostAn execution environment or external platform.
ContainerA grouped runtime unit hosted by a Host.
ProcessA running service or executable component.
LibraryA reusable code dependency outside runtime containment.

Rules:

  • Every node has metadata.ownership, whose value is first_party or third_party.
  • first_party means the system publisher owns or controls the component's implementation or operation. third_party means an external provider owns or controls it.
  • Exactly one node has kind Root; its ID equals rootNodeId and it has no parent.
  • Every Host has the Root as parent.
  • Every Container has a Host parent.
  • Every Process has a Host or Container parent.
  • Library has no parent. Process and Library cannot contain children.
  • IDs are unique and match ^[A-Za-z0-9._:-]+$.
  • The containment graph is acyclic.
  • Metadata is open-ended beyond the required, typed ownership member. Boundary, ID prefixes, host naming, and other metadata are not required by v1.

Source selectors

sourceSelectors is optional. An exact path selects itself. A selector ending in /** selects that directory and descendants. No other wildcard syntax is defined.

Every selector MUST match at least one Manifest path. Multiple nodes MAY select the same path and some source paths MAY remain unassigned.

Edges

Edge types are closed in v1:

TypeSourceTargetCycle rule
RuntimeProcessProcess or ContainerCycles allowed.
DataflowProcessProcess or ContainerProjected graph must be acyclic.
DependencyProcessLibraryGraph must be acyclic.

Root and Host cannot be edge endpoints under these rules. A Container target represents an opaque routing boundary.

Optional context

system.context MAY contain concerns, shared documents, matrix assignments, system prompts, and node-local artifacts. Omitting context does not reduce graph conformance.

Concerns

Concerns are explicitly declared. The recommended interoperable vocabulary is:

  1. Features
  2. General Specs
  3. General Skills
  4. Data Model
  5. Interfaces
  6. Connectivity
  7. Security
  8. Implementation
  9. Deployment

Projects MAY use a subset and MAY declare additional concerns. Names are case-sensitive.

Documents, skills, and prompts

Shared input kinds are Document, Skill, and Prompt:

Compute the hash from UTF-8 bytes of:

kind + "\n" + title + "\n" + language + "\n" + text

supersedes is excluded. Supersession chains MUST be acyclic. Missing predecessors are allowed so a snapshot need not contain its entire history.

Matrix assignments connect a node, a declared concern, and one or more Document or Skill hashes. References MUST resolve to documents of the corresponding kind.

Prompts are not ordinary matrix references. systemPromptRefs belongs to context, references only Prompt documents, and applies only to the Root.

Artifacts

Artifact types are Summary, Docs, and Code. Each belongs to one node and one declared concern.

  • Summary and Docs carry UTF-8 text and optional language.
  • Code carries sourcePaths that resolve to Manifest files.
  • Code MUST NOT duplicate file contents already present in the embedded Bundle.

Artifact IDs are unique within the system.

Validation order

A consumer SHOULD validate in this order:

  1. Top-level schema and embedded Sources.
  2. Node IDs, root, containment, and parent kinds.
  3. Edge endpoints and cycle rules.
  4. Source selectors.
  5. Concern declarations and document hashes.
  6. Matrix, prompt, artifact, and supersession references.

Unknown metadata keys MUST be preserved. Unknown node, edge, document, or artifact kinds are invalid in v1.
